Baidu, Inc.BIDUNASDAQ
Loading
ROIC: Returns DecliningContracting
Percentile Rank7
3Y CAGR-16.3%
5Y CAGR-13.1%
Year-over-Year Change

Return on invested capital

3Y CAGR
-16.3%/yr
vs -8.8%/yr prior
5Y CAGR
-13.1%/yr
Recent deceleration
Acceleration
-7.5pp
Decelerating
Percentile
P7
Near historical low
vs 5Y Ago
0.5x
Contraction
Streak
2 yr
Consecutive declineContracting
PeriodValueYoY Change
20252.08%-57.3%
20244.87%-8.2%
20235.30%+49.7%
20223.54%+54.5%
20212.29%-45.3%
20204.19%+154.8%
2019-7.65%-249.4%
20185.12%-32.6%
20177.60%+37.9%
20165.51%-